Abstract
A method of controlled delivery of breathing gases is described the method comprising: applying breathing gas pressure within the first naris of a patient during inhalation; applying breathing gas pressure within the second naris of the patient during inhalation; applying breathing gas pressure within the first naris of the patient during exhalation; and applying breathing gas pressure within the second naris of the patient during exhalation, wherein the breathing gas pressure applied to the first naris during inhalation is higher than the gas pressure applied to the second naris during inhalation and the breathing gas inflow to the patient is substantially through the first naris during inhalation and wherein the breathing gas pressure applied to the first naris during exhalation is lower than the gas pressure applied to the second naris during exhalation and the gas outflow from the patient is substantially through the first naris during exhalation. An apparatus and system implementing the method is also described.
